码迷,mamicode.com
首页 > 数据库 > 详细

解决ERROR 1130 (HY000): Host '192.168.1.9' is not allowed to connect to this MySQL server

时间:2015-02-19 15:09:03      阅读:221      评论:0      收藏:0      [点我收藏+]

标签:

本机是mysql的数据库,想用另一台ip为192.168.1.9的连接这个mysql数据库,可是报了这个错误。

查询得到2个方法

第一个是在user表把localhost改为%, 我这么做后不仅没有解决,本地连接都要root@%这么做了(现在想想好像失误把所有localhost都给改了)。

第二个方法就生效了。

终端登陆mysql,执行一句sql:

GRANT ALL PRIVILEGES ON *.* TO ‘root‘@‘192.168.1.9‘ IDENTIFIED BY ‘chaojimima‘ WITH GRANT OPTION;

其中‘chaojimima‘就是设定连接密码了,然后192.168.1.9就可以连接了,简单有效,不是任意主机都可连,也安全一些。

解决ERROR 1130 (HY000): Host '192.168.1.9' is not allowed to connect to this MySQL server

标签:

原文地址:http://blog.csdn.net/u010211892/article/details/43882681

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!